We Make Morrisons…
From a Bradford market stall to the UK’s fifth largest supermarket, we are proud to be the Yorkshire food retailer serving customers across the UK with nearly 500 stores and an online home delivery service.
Our business primarily focuses on food & grocery, and uniquely, we source & process most of the fresh food we sell through our own manufacturing facilities.
We are recruiting a high-performing Trading Manager to help our business continue to grow and succeed.
Ensuring our stores are fully stocked is crucial for a fantastic customer experience, making this role vital to our success. The Trading Manager is responsible for providing the best availability and standards across all departments, ensuring compliance with legal and safety standards.
Reporting to the Store Manager, your responsibilities will include:
* Leading the team to the highest standards and ensuring the best shopping experience for every customer
* Planning and organizing current promotions and in-store events
* Listening to customer feedback and responding appropriately
* Ensuring market-leading product availability across the store
* Collaborating with other managers to lead a supportive and performance-driven department
* Managing all people routines, including scheduling, absence, performance, and talent development
* Delivering training to empower the team to perform confidently in their roles
* Motivating colleagues to work confidently across departments
* Identifying and developing talent within the department
* Building effective relationships with other operational departments
* Leading colleagues to achieve outstanding performance against targets
* Taking a leadership role within the store
* Planning resources thoroughly
